云计算:概念、历史、特性与服务类型解析
1. 云计算的基本概念
云计算就如同自来水系统。想象一下,如果没有自来水,每个家庭都得自己挖井。挖井成本高,维护也贵,而且难以快速获取大量水,不用了还没法回收成本。而自来水则是由他人投资建设和管理基础设施,确保水干净且随时可用,用户只需按使用量付费。云计算也是如此,它将数据中心资源像自来水一样提供给用户,始终在线,用户按需付费。
从本质上讲,云计算是实用计算这一长期梦想的实现。“云”是互联网的隐喻,源于计算机网络绘图中用云表示互联网。实用计算意味着用户可以使用计算资源,并按使用量付费,就像支付水、电、电话服务费用一样。
2. 云计算的发展历程
云计算的发展历程包含在多种环境中的应用,主要有以下几种系统:
2.1 分时系统
云计算起源于20世纪60年代的分时系统。在分时系统出现之前,程序员用穿孔卡片或磁带输入代码,机器依次同步执行作业,效率极低,计算机存在大量闲置时间。
- 分时概念的提出 :IBM计算机科学家Bob Bemer在《自动控制杂志》上提出分时概念。分时利用处理器等待I/O的时间,将这些时间片分配给其他用户。由于要同时处理多个用户,系统需维护每个用户和程序的状态,并能快速切换。
- 早期项目实践 :John McCarthy在IBM 704大型机上启动了第一个实现分时系统的项目,产生了兼容分时系统(CTSS)。CTSS具备了如今一些被视为理所当然的技术基本要素,如文本格式化、用户间消息传递、基本的shell和脚本编写能力。后来,CTSS发展为Multics,启发了Uni
超级会员免费看
订阅专栏 解锁全文
57

被折叠的 条评论
为什么被折叠?



